PSG vs FC Lorient : Luis Enrique's first is a success despite the draw.
Tumblr media
Ladies, Gentlemen, Gays and Theys. It is the official start of the 2023-2024 football season and for us PSG supporters, that means the comeback of the most entertaining drama show that gives Game of Thrones a run for their money. But today, we'll talk football.
I am delighted to anounce that it also means the comeback of the Football theses. For those of you that are unfamiliar with this format, they're game reviews where I try breaking down what I think we did right, what's missing, and where I give my tops and flops.
This is the first game. Therefore it's way too early to draw conclusions, which means it'll be brief. It's also a new season with a hectic but diverse mercato, and a brand new coach who is one of the greatest in Europe and who we should give time to adapt. Yet, I think he's already made his mark.
Lorient is very far off posing any kind of threat. They ranked 10th last year and we've won both games against them last year. So a final score of 0-0 might send everyone into panicked frenzy, and people might already decide the faith of our team this season.
That is if you haven't watched the game.
Because let me tell you : we might not have scored, or had that many great opportunities, but we played football. And as ridiculous as that sounds, after last season, that in itself is a HUGE step in the right direction for the club.
Enrique has brought in his Spanish football way, which is the ball possession way. 97% possession in the first 10 minutes, 77.8% by the end of the matcch and a total of ONE. THOUSAND (1000) passes, making it the first team to do that in a Ligue 1 game in History. Ball possession can be a questionable play choice in an era where football leans more towards transition, but we'll take it for now because that was the most eager pressing I've seen from a PSG team in years.
Not only did Paris dominate in keeping the ball, they were also masters in ball recovery. They were such a compact block some thought there were 13 players on the pitch, not 11. *Hang on, I need to wipe my tears. Never in my LIFE did I ever think I would type that about PSG.* The Red and Blues have recovered a total of 24 balls in the opposite half, making it the HIGHEST TOTAL for a Top 5 European team in the last 10. years. I know, I can't believe it either. PSG, you guys. PSG recovering balls. I'm about to go in the lockeroom put salt in the corners to protect our players from evil eye.
Anyway, this shows that Enrique has brought in a real game identity and that is something I am ecstatic about.
So what did we miss ?
With PSG, there's always something missing. We finally have an eager group that wants to play together, our defense is finally FINALLY reassuring. But unfortunately, when one problem is solved, another arises.
The midfield is no longer the black hole it was last year, but it is now...loading. Despite WZE's talent and Vitinha showing more capability than he has last year, new players need time. We no longer have a creative player in the squad, a playmaker, and most importantly : we lack dynamism and percussion in the attack. We need players that are quicker, not only in pace but in decsion making, that are capable of that spark of genius that will unlock the trick. They were in the stands last night.
Tops:
Danilo Perreira: THE real capi. I don't care, he was one of the best players last night, and he lead by example in intensity.
Lucas Hernandez : I pray that he doesn't get hurt. Dude is monstruous and deserved getting that first applause of the game.
Warren Zaire-Emery : absolute crack. I cannot wait to see him become one of the best midfielders of his generation.
Flops: it's too early to tell. There was a lot of great potential shown, and although some players took some time getting their head in the games (Hakimi), they still ended the game properly.
Carlos Soler.
Hugo Ekitike.
Overall, I am very optimistic despite the frustrating result.
As some of the Lorient players interviewed said: PSG is now more about teamwork, and less about individuality and talent. To make a great team, you need both. The truth always lays in the middle.

Little House in the Big Woods; Farmer Boy, by Laura Ingllas Wilder
So I read the series in reverse, but I figured it would be kind of hard to write about them that way if I group them together, so I'm going to write these in chronological order.
Big Woods as a story is very sweet. It really embodies the coziness that everyone talks about, really more so than any other book besides Farmer Boy.
Is all childhood memories. Ma making butter, and roasting pig's tail, Pa playing his fiddle and telling stories, holidays and celebrations with family.
Laura at the age of four and five is pretty carefree, as it should be.
It's odd, reading kids books when you're an adult, you get subtext that you probably wouldn't have gotten as a kid.
This happens more and more as the books go on, but in this one, I got something that I don't know was the intent or if I'm reading too much into it.
Big Woods starts out like a fairy tale, and it continues with that tone, and it makes me wonder if Wilder didn't, in some way, think back on that time as ideal because there really is a sense of safety as you follow Laura through the chores and games, and squabbles. The feel is carefree in a way that is mostly lost when the family goes west. I don't know how much kids will get when they read them, but I was always aware of the danger that the Ingallses faced. From Little House on the Prairie, forward, it is under the surface if not actively present. Big Woods, had the bear, but everything is very secure.
The ending is probably one of the most elegant pieces of writing that wasn't about nature, in the whole series.
"She thought to herself, 'This is now.' She was glad that the cozy house, and Pa and Ma and the firelight and the music, were now. They could not be forgotten, she thought, because now is now. It can never be a long time ago."
Farmer Boy, was written as a companion piece to Big Woods, according to Prarie Fires and the podcast. I cannot express how adorable I think that is.
This book follows a year in the life of nine year old Almanzo Wilder, near Malone, New York. It is even cozier than Big Woods. There are so many descriptions of food, I found myself getting hungry when reading it, and that usually doesn't happen to me. Big Woods, there was more to it, Almanzo is old enough to know something of his own mind, to get into scrapes and to interact with others more than Laura who was only five in the first book.
Plus, because the real Laura was working off of things told to her by her husband, a lot of the book is probably more fiction and has a clearer story arch, at least to me.
It was really interesting to me watching Almanzo learn the farming trade and all the various skills needed to go along with it, and just how much he enjoyed it. I think my favorite parts were when Almanzo was allowed to stay home from school and help out on the farm from threshing wheat, hauling timber, training young oxen, whatever, Almanzo was eager to learn.
Something that caught my attention near the end.
There's this point where a wagon maker in town asks Almanzo's father to apprentice Almanzo.
His father talks to his mother about it, and his mother is very upset, and goes on a rant about how if he did this, Almanzo would never be free, and would always be dependent on others for his living.
Now, there is this odd idea in the LH Fandom (community? It's huge, I don't know) that Laura and Almanzo's daughter Rose actually wrote the books. Honestly, and I will come back this in another ramble, if you read Pioneer Girl and you read Rose's writing, this is obviously not the case (IMO). But we do know, that Rose, was involved in editing her mother's books, and Laura did allow Rose to add things. Both mother and daughter's writing have the thread of being free and independent, but the tone is very different between the two.
This section feels like an addition made by Rose. She was a staunch Libritarian and her writing in its vein usually has a feel of righteous anger or frustration, telling the reader what's what.
Laura's shows the reader how one would do this, and is much quieter
This speech by Almanzo's mother is very out of character for the busy sweet natured woman in the rest of the book, and right after this tirade the tone goes back to normal. Almost as if it can be lifted out completely.
It was interesting to compare it to the rest of the book.
All in all, I enjoyed these two.
